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: Nearly all 2001, 2002 & 2003 goldwing 1800 motorcycles has serious overheating problem when driven 10-20 mph. must be pulled over to cool. i was traveling i90 through chicago, engine overheated 2x's. due to construction work, no place to pull over. potentially life threatening. honda has not addressed problem, despite numerious complaints by owners. now starting 3rd year of sales. it is only a matter of time before accident happens. *ak
